Yes, El Super Accepts EBT

The most important question is, does El Super accept EBT? Yes, El Super does indeed accept EBT cards as a form of payment for eligible food items. This means you can use your SNAP benefits to buy groceries at El Super, just like you would at many other major grocery chains.

What Can You Buy with EBT at El Super?

When using your EBT card at El Super, there are certain things you can and cannot purchase. Generally, SNAP benefits are designed for purchasing food that you can cook at home.

Here’s a quick rundown of some things you can typically buy:

  • Fruits and vegetables (fresh, frozen, or canned)
  • Meat, poultry, and fish
  • Dairy products (milk, cheese, yogurt)
  • Breads and cereals
  • Snack foods (chips, cookies, etc.)
  • Non-alcoholic beverages

However, there are some exceptions. Prepared foods, alcohol, and tobacco are not eligible. Knowing these guidelines helps you shop effectively.

Additionally, you can only purchase food items with your EBT card. For example, pet food, diapers, and hygiene products are generally not covered by SNAP.

How to Pay with EBT at El Super

Paying with your EBT card at El Super is easy. The process is similar to using a regular debit card. When you’re checking out, tell the cashier that you’re paying with EBT. They will then swipe your card through the card reader.

You’ll need to enter your PIN (Personal Identification Number), just like with any debit card. Make sure you keep your PIN safe and don’t share it with anyone! The amount of your SNAP benefits will then be deducted from your EBT card balance.

  1. Separate your EBT-eligible items from non-eligible items.
  2. Inform the cashier you are paying with EBT.
  3. Swipe your card and enter your PIN.
  4. Pay for any non-eligible items separately using cash or another payment method.

The receipt will show you how much of your EBT benefits you used and how much is left on your card.

Tips for Using EBT at El Super

To make the most of your EBT benefits at El Super, here are some helpful tips. First, plan your shopping trip ahead of time. Make a list of the foods you need and check your pantry and refrigerator to avoid buying duplicates.

Compare prices to make sure you are getting the best deals. El Super often has sales and promotions on various items, so be sure to take advantage of those opportunities. Also, be aware of unit prices (the price per ounce or pound), which can help you compare different brands and sizes.

  • Plan your meals for the week.
  • Compare prices on different brands.
  • Take advantage of sales and promotions.
  • Check the unit prices.

Keep track of your EBT balance to stay within your budget. Check your receipt after each purchase to see how much you have left. You can also contact your local EBT office or check your balance online. Finally, remember that some El Super locations might have specific policies or procedures.
